+ /**
+ * \param o the object to copy.
+ *
+ * Allow subclasses to implement a copy constructor.
+ * While it is technically possible to implement a copy
+ * constructor in a subclass, we strongly discourage you
+ * to do so. If you really want to do it anyway, you have
+ * to understand that this copy constructor will _not_
+ * copy aggregated objects. i.e., if your object instance
+ * is already aggregated to another object and if you invoke
+ * this copy constructor, the new object instance will be
+ * a pristine standlone object instance not aggregated to
+ * any other object. It is thus _your_ responsability
+ * as a caller of this method to do what needs to be done
+ * (if it is needed) to ensure that the object stays in a
+ * valid state.
+ */
+ Object (const Object &o);
